The video content creation industry has experienced tremendous growth over the past decade. The proliferation of social media, YouTube, TikTok, and streaming services has created an unprecedented demand for high-quality video content. Brands, businesses, and individuals are constantly looking for innovative ways to connect with their audiences, share their stories, and showcase their products or services.
